Запуск Torchlight 2 под Wine

Нативные и в Wine/Cedega - проблемы, настройка, обсуждение

Модератор: Модераторы разделов

Ответить
YurasNwN
Сообщения: 14

Запуск Torchlight 2 под Wine

Сообщение YurasNwN »

Добрый день!
Пытался запустить Torchlight 2 под Linux Mint "maya". Сама игра запускается, звук идет,но вместо графики отобржается какой-то цветной шум.
Запускал под Wine 1.7.13 и PLayOnLinux, происходит одно и тоже. На WineHQ пишут что запустилась без проблем, но у меня не вышло.
В консоли выводятся подобные сообщения:

Код:

err:d3d_draw:drawStridedFast >>>>>>>>>>>>>>>>> GL_INVALID_FRAMEBUFFER_OPERATION (0x506) from glDrawElementsBaseVertex @ drawprim.c / 73 fixme:d3d:context_check_fbo_status FBO status GL_FRAMEBUFFER_INCOMPLETE_DRAW_BUFFER (0x8cdb) fixme:d3d:context_check_fbo_status Location WINED3D_LOCATION_RB_MULTISAMPLE (0x100). fixme:d3d:context_check_fbo_status Color attachment 0: (0xbb41110) WINED3DFMT_B8G8R8X8_UNORM 1280x1024 2 samples. fixme:d3d:context_check_fbo_status Depth attachment: (0xaee3150) WINED3DFMT_S8_UINT_D24_FLOAT 1280x1024 2 samples.


Компьютер: AMD Phenom X4 955, 2GB Ram, AMD Radeon HD4850. Установлены драйвера от видеокарты с официального сайта и DX9 через winetricks.
Спасибо сказали:
NickLion
Сообщения: 3408
Статус: аватар-невидимка
ОС: openSUSE Tumbleweed x86_64

Re: Запуск Torchlight 2 под Wine

Сообщение NickLion »

Какая версия игры? Стим, или от runic не стим?
Спасибо сказали:
YurasNwN
Сообщения: 14

Re: Запуск Torchlight 2 под Wine

Сообщение YurasNwN »

Версия игры 1.25.5.2 отученная от стима.
Спасибо сказали:
NickLion
Сообщения: 3408
Статус: аватар-невидимка
ОС: openSUSE Tumbleweed x86_64

Re: Запуск Torchlight 2 под Wine

Сообщение NickLion »

А зачем отучивать от стима? Можно стим в wine поставить, нормально работает. Если это "торрент версия", то тут может быть в этом и причина, любое крякание может привести к неработоспособности в wine. Проверьте free demo с сайта. Если на нём всё в порядке, то скорее всего проблема в той "отучивалке".
Спасибо сказали:
YurasNwN
Сообщения: 14

Re: Запуск Torchlight 2 под Wine

Сообщение YurasNwN »

Имеется именно торрент версия. Сейчас установил free demo с офиц. сайта, все равно такая же ерунда творится на мониторе. Свободные драйвера frglx, которые доступны в репозитории тоже не дают положительного эффекта. Также пробовал менять рендер DirectDraw - ничего не вышло хорошего.
скрин
Спасибо сказали:
NickLion
Сообщения: 3408
Статус: аватар-невидимка
ОС: openSUSE Tumbleweed x86_64

Re: Запуск Torchlight 2 под Wine

Сообщение NickLion »

Пробовали создать чистый префикс, WINEPREFIX=~/.wine123 wine ...torchlight setup.exe
Спасибо сказали:
YurasNwN
Сообщения: 14

Re: Запуск Torchlight 2 под Wine

Сообщение YurasNwN »

ну я пробовал затирать каталог .wine в домашней директории и заново устанавливать, все равно не работает.
я так понимаю это равносильные вещи? К тому же PlayOnLinux вроде делает то же самое.
Спасибо сказали:
ShadowFlash
Сообщения: 162
ОС: Kubuntu 14.04 LTS, MacOS 10.9

Re: Запуск Torchlight 2 под Wine

Сообщение ShadowFlash »

Может быть с радеоном проблемы? У меня nVidia и стимовская версия - все отлично, просто работает из коробки. А картинка напоминает попытку запустить 4 года назад Ragnarok Online под вайном на ноуте жены. А там был HD4330 - по сути примерно одно и то же, только слабее в разы.
Можно еще попробовать в wine эмуляцию десктопа включить, но вряд-ли поможет.

P.S. Отучалка тут точно к делу не относится, проблемы с ними всегда приводят к тому, что игра либо не стартует, либо прекрасно работает, но не сохраняется.
Спасибо сказали:
Аватара пользователя
drBatty
Сообщения: 8735
Статус: GPG ID: 4DFBD1D6 дом горит, козёл не видит...
ОС: Slackware-current
Контактная информация:

Re: Запуск Torchlight 2 под Wine

Сообщение drBatty »

YurasNwN писал(а):
04.03.2014 14:55
ну я пробовал затирать каталог .wine в домашней директории и заново устанавливать, все равно не работает.
я так понимаю это равносильные вещи?

нет.

А проблема ИМХО в кривом железе. Wine это всё-таки эмулятор, хотя и не эмулятор Windows.
http://emulek.blogspot.ru/ Windows Must Die
Учебник по sed зеркало в github

Скоро придёт
Осень
Спасибо сказали:
NickLion
Сообщения: 3408
Статус: аватар-невидимка
ОС: openSUSE Tumbleweed x86_64

Re: Запуск Torchlight 2 под Wine

Сообщение NickLion »

drBatty писал(а):
07.03.2014 10:10
YurasNwN писал(а):
04.03.2014 14:55
ну я пробовал затирать каталог .wine в домашней директории и заново устанавливать, все равно не работает.
я так понимаю это равносильные вещи?

нет.

А в чём разница? Конфигурации различаются.
Спасибо сказали:
Аватара пользователя
drBatty
Сообщения: 8735
Статус: GPG ID: 4DFBD1D6 дом горит, козёл не видит...
ОС: Slackware-current
Контактная информация:

Re: Запуск Torchlight 2 под Wine

Сообщение drBatty »

NickLion писал(а):
07.03.2014 10:34
А в чём разница?

обычно под "по новой ставить" понимают удаление/установка самого wine. При этом ~/.wine не меняется.

кроме того, ваша команда успешно сделает новый префикс, но 95% пользователей будут пользоваться всё равно старым ~/.wine/, а не вашим новым ~/.wine123/.

Но если ТС относится к 5%, то он конечно понял вас правильно. С другой стороны, зачем он тогда тему создал?
http://emulek.blogspot.ru/ Windows Must Die
Учебник по sed зеркало в github

Скоро придёт
Осень
Спасибо сказали:
Аватара пользователя
Bizdelnick
Модератор
Сообщения: 20752
Статус: nulla salus bello
ОС: Debian GNU/Linux

Re: Запуск Torchlight 2 под Wine

Сообщение Bizdelnick »

drBatty писал(а):
07.03.2014 10:41
обычно под "по новой ставить" понимают удаление/установка самого wine.

А разве речь шла об этом?

NickLion писал(а):
04.03.2014 13:41
Пробовали создать чистый префикс, WINEPREFIX=~/.wine123 wine ...torchlight setup.exe

Пишите правильно:
в консоли
вку́пе (с чем-либо)
в общем
вообще
в течение (часа)
новичок
нюанс
по умолчанию
приемлемо
проблема
пробовать
трафик
Спасибо сказали:
NickLion
Сообщения: 3408
Статус: аватар-невидимка
ОС: openSUSE Tumbleweed x86_64

Re: Запуск Torchlight 2 под Wine

Сообщение NickLion »

drBatty
Заново устанавливать, насколько я понял, имелось в виду игру, а не wine.
Спасибо сказали:
Аватара пользователя
drBatty
Сообщения: 8735
Статус: GPG ID: 4DFBD1D6 дом горит, козёл не видит...
ОС: Slackware-current
Контактная информация:

Re: Запуск Torchlight 2 под Wine

Сообщение drBatty »

Bizdelnick писал(а):
07.03.2014 11:21
А разве речь шла об этом?

а я не знаю…
http://emulek.blogspot.ru/ Windows Must Die
Учебник по sed зеркало в github

Скоро придёт
Осень
Спасибо сказали:
YurasNwN
Сообщения: 14

Re: Запуск Torchlight 2 под Wine

Сообщение YurasNwN »

Пробовали создать чистый префикс, WINEPREFIX=~/.wine123 wine ...torchlight setup.exe

Сделал новый префикс, установил Torchlight, и все равно та же ерунда. Запускал так: env WINEPREFIX=~/.winetorch2 wine '/home/yurgen/.winetorch2/drive_c/Program Files/Runic Games/Torchlight 2/tl2.runic.launcher.exe'
А PlayOnLiunx все-таки сам создает новые префиксы, только они названы там виртуальными дисками.
Может это проблема в графическом окружении Cinnamon или в чем-то еще? Ну или действительно железо кривое,как выше замечали.
Извиняюсь если что не так назвал.
Спасибо сказали:
YurasNwN
Сообщения: 14

Re: Запуск Torchlight 2 под Wine

Сообщение YurasNwN »

Появились новые подвижки в этом деле. Надо было в настройках wine через winetricks или в настройках Playonlinux выставить режим рендеринга Offscreen равным backbuffer. Теперь игра запустилась, правда лагает и звук то появляется, то исчезает, но это видимо из-за эмуляции через wine.
Заметил одну особенность при работе после установки драйверов AMD. Иногда при открытии нового окна какого-либо приложения, начинается такая же ерунда с артефактами на экране и иногда перезапускается оконный менеджер (исчезает паель задач с рамками окон и после вновь запускается)
Спасибо сказали:
Lorte
Сообщения: 319

Re: Запуск Torchlight 2 под Wine

Сообщение Lorte »

Попробуйте под Wine поставить DirectX через winetricks.
Спасибо сказали:
YurasNwN
Сообщения: 14

Re: Запуск Torchlight 2 под Wine

Сообщение YurasNwN »

Lorte писал(а):
17.03.2014 10:56
Попробуйте под Wine поставить DirectX через winetricks.


Установил. Особого производительности не прибавилось, поэтому отключил в игре динамические тени. Стало пошустрее.
Наверное лучше не добиться из-за того что WINE всего лишь эмулятор
Спасибо сказали:
Ответить